12 Months Job Description Content Studio's Strategic Operations & Program Management (SO&PM) team sits within the Communications & Public Affairs organization and serves as the operational backbone of Content Studio. The team drives clarity, speed, and efficiency across Content Studio by leading strategic planning, program management for large-scale initiatives, and cross-functional coordination. We are seeking a Contract Program Manager to support our Program Management function. This role will drive end-to-end planning, execution, and delivery of large-scale social, creative, and communications programs
  • partnering cross-functionally with creative strategists, social teams, communications leads, and external agency partners.
This person will be critical in maintaining flawless execution across high-priority initiatives spanning flagship events, product launches, policy campaigns, and organizational programs. Responsibilities Drive end-to-end project management for large-scale, cross-functional programs and campaigns across Content Studio (e.g., flagship events, product launches, policy/social campaigns), including developing project plans, timelines, RACI frameworks, and workback schedules Coordinate across creative, social, comms, and PA teams to align workstreams, manage dependencies, lead status meetings, and track deliverables
  • flagging risks early and driving resolution of blockers Support strategic planning processes including roadmapping, resource allocation, goal-setting, and the development and socialization of organizational processes Build and refine operational processes, templates, and frameworks that scale across Content Studio, including support for tool migrations, workflow documentation, and knowledge management Partner with external agency teams and vendors on deliverable alignment and timelines, and support the expansion of centralized program management capabilities across the Comms & PA organization Minimum Qualifications 7+ years of project or program management experience in marketing, communications, creative, or media environments Demonstrated experience managing large-scale, multi-stakeholder programs with complex timelines and cross-functional dependencies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ple workstreams simultaneously and maintain meticulous attention to detail Excellent written and verbal communication skills•able to distill complexity into clear updates for leadership and cross-functional partners Proficiency with project management tools (e.
